Yogurt Chips Substitute for White chocolate: Exact Ratio
Looking for a white chocolate substitute? Yogurt Chips works as a direct replacement. Use 1 cup yogurt chips per 1 cup white chocolate chips in any recipe that calls for white chocolate. This swap works best for cookies, trail mix, dipping fruit.

Flavor & Texture Change
Tangy and sweet instead of purely sweet. Distinct yogurt flavor.
When Not to Use
Tangier and more yogurt-flavored. Melting behavior differs. Not a true chocolate product.
